Baseball Swept By Houston, 10-2

BATON ROUGE, La. — Tyson Schweitzer’s pinch-hit grand slam ignited a five-run seventh inning to propel Houston to a 10-2 victory over LSU Sunday at Alex Box Stadium, completing a three-game sweep for the Cougars.

The Tigers (6-5), which have lost five in a row for the first time since 1985, host Nicholls St. Tuesday at 7 p.m.

The series marked the first time LSU has been swept in a three-game series at home since losing three to Auburn in 1988, and the first time the Tigers have been swept in a non-conference series since dropping a series at Wichita State in 1988.

The Cougars held a 2-1 lead through six innings, and led off the seventh with a single by Eric Lee and a sacrifice bunt by Aaron Melebeck. Sean Allen signled Lee to third, then Lee came home on Jason Pekar’s RBI double, driving starter Billy Brian (1-2) from the game.

Reliever Tim Nugent hit Brandon Caraway to load the bases, then Schweitzer hit Nugent’s 1-1 offering over the right-field fence.

The Tigers had 11 hits, all singles, and scored in the third on Mike Fontenot’s base hit and in the eighth on Victory Brumfield’s ground out.
